Healthy Homestyle Chicken & Vegetable Stew
A hearty, wholesome chicken stew loaded with lean chicken breast, tender vegetables, and a rich herb-infused broth. This comforting one-pot meal is packed with protein, vegetables, and flavor while staying light and healthy.
Ingredients
- 1½ lbs boneless skinless ch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 medium on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 3 carrots, sliced
- 3 celery stalks, sliced
- 2 cups baby potatoes, halved
- 1 cup mushrooms, sliced
- 1 cup frozen peas
- 4 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 1 tbsp tomato paste
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 1 tsp dried rosemary
- 1 tsp paprika
- 2 bay leaves
- 2 tbsp c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p water (optional)
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Season the chicken with paprika, salt, and pepper.
- Heat olive o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at and brown the chicken for 4–5 minutes.
- Add the onion and garlic and cook until fragrant.
- Stir in the tomato paste and cook for 1 minute.
- Pour in the chicken broth and add thyme, rosemary, and bay leaves.
- Bring to a boil, re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es.
- Add the carrots, celery, potatoes, and mushrooms. Simmer for another 20 minutes.
- Stir in the peas during the final 5 minutes.
- If desired, stir in the cornstarch slurry until the stew thickens.
- Remove the bay leaves, garnish with parsley, and serve warm.

Notes
- Chicken thighs can be substituted for extra flavor.
- This stew reheats beautifully.
- Freeze leftovers for up to 3 months.

Storage
Refrigerate for up to 4 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
Variations
- Add spinach during the last few minutes.
- Use sweet potatoes instead of baby potatoes.
- Stir in white beans for additional fiber.
- Add corn for extra sweetness.
Substitutions
- Turkey breast instead of chicken.
- Arrowroot instead of cornstarch.
- Fresh thyme instead of dried.
FAQ
Can I make this in a slow cooker?
Yes. Cook on Low for 6–7 hours or High for 3–4 hours.
Can I freeze chicken stew?
Yes. Let it cool completely before freezing in airtight containers.
Can I use rotisserie chicken?
Yes. Add cooked rotisserie chicken during the last 10 minutes of cooking.
